Rob Dyrdek has not officially retired from skateboarding, but he has shifted his focus primarily to business ventures and entertainment. While he occasionally skates for fun or during special events, he is no longer actively competing or participating in professional skateboarding. His work in television and his entrepreneurial pursuits have taken precedence over his skateboarding career.
